Demolition and site work for an educational facility in San Diego, California. Completed plans call for the demolition of a educational facility; and for site work for a educational facility.

This project consists of the demolition and abatement of existing structures located at the current Chancellor's Complex (Phase 01). The work includes hazardous materials abatement in accordance with applicable regulations, structural demolition, and removal of all debris to prepare the site for future development. The design scope included in this package is limited to interim grading, erosion control measures, drainage solutions, and application of mulch to stabilize and protect the site until the future construction phase commences. These interim improvements are intended to minimize environmental impacts and maintain compliance with stormwater and dust control regulations. Note on UC 965 Site is considered Future Phase Work, and while the UC 965 building is part of the overall Chancellor Site Restoration scope, its associated demolition and abatement work is anticipated to occur during Phase 2, which is not part of this current bid package. This package includes only preliminary design elements for the 965 area such as grading, erosion control, and temporary site stabilization. Demolition of the UC 965 structure will be addressed under a future contract and separate procurement process. The project will comply with the University of California Policy on Sustainable Practices, and UC San Diego design guidelines. The Sustainable Practices Policy establishes goals for green building, clean energy, transportation, climate protection, facilities operations, zero waste, procurement, food service, and water systems. The University has bid and awarded a CM at Risk Contract to McCarthy Building Companies, Inc. (hereafter "CM/Contractor"). CM/Contractor is responsible for bidding and awarding all subsequent subcontractor packages, including this package. The successful Subcontractor Bidder shall sign a Subcontract Agreement directly with CM/Contractor, and shall be bound by all the terms of the contract between University and CM/Contractor. Every effort will be made to ensure that all persons have equal access to contracts and other business opportunities with the University within the limits imposed by law or University policy. Each Bidder may be required to show evidence of its equal employment opportunity policy. The successful Bidder and its subcontractors will be required to follow the nondiscrimination requirements set forth in the contract between the University and the CM/Contractor, and to pay prevailing wage at the location of the work. No contractor or subcontractor, regardless of tier, may be listed on a Bid for, or engage in the performance of, any portion of this project, unless registered with the Department of Industrial Relations pursuant to Labor Code section 1725.5 and 1771.1.
